Fine art photography refers to photographs that are created to fulfill the creative vision of the artist. Fine art photography stands in contrast to photojournalism and commercial photography and general happy snaps. Photojournalism provides visual support for stories, mainly in the print media. Commercial photography's main focus is to sell a product or service. Happy snaps are simply taken without applying widely accepted professional photographic practices of composition and technique.
